Blues is a music genre with deep roots in African American culture, originating in the late 19th century in the southern United States. Its emotionally rich melodies, improvisation, and storytelling lyrics have influenced many other genres – from rock to jazz. More than just music, blues is a life story told through sound and words, reflecting joy, sorrow, and freedom.
